Karnataka chief minister BS Yeddyurappa today said he intended to focus more on reviewing developmental works in the state.Inaugurating the fourth edition of Kannada daily Hosa Digantha here today, he said he along with chief secretary SV Ranganath and financial advisor, professor KV Raju would visit each district every Saturday to monitor the developmental works being undertaken there.Emphasising the need for credibility in journalism, Yeddyurappa called upon the fourth estate to be "responsible and not send wrong messages to the public".
